Jeanette L. Barnell

Jeanette L. Barnell, Age 76, of Cedar Rapids, IA, passed away at the Oldorf Hospice House on Thursday, January 30, 2025, surrounded by her loving family.

A Celebration of Life will be held on Saturday, February 15, 2025, from 9 AM until 11:30 AM at the Fairfax Community Room, 300 80th Street, Fairfax. 

Jeanette was born on March 24, 1948, in Pomona, CA. She was the daughter of the late Calvin and Marie (Conger) Farris. She married the love of her life, Kenneth Barnell. She worked in childcare for many years before her retirement. Jeanette loved watching Court Television and Game Shows. She enjoyed going to the Casino and doing crossword puzzles. Jeanette’s greatest joy in life was spending time with her family especially her grandchildren. 

Those left to cherish Jeanette’s memory are her children, Brigitte (Mike) Steimel, of Cedar Rapids, IA, Kenny (Michelle) Barnell, of Fairfax, IA, and Joe (Krista) Barnell, of Cedar Rapids, IA; her grandchildren, Hannah, Hope, Hailey, Brynlee, Masen, Calvin, and Madeline; her sister, Janet (David) Hawley, of Elk Run Heights, IA. She was preceded in death by her husband, her parents, a brother, Dennis Farris, and her cat, Mr. Doodles.

In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the Dennis and Donna Oldorf Hospice House.

The family would like to thank all of the staff at both Irving Point and the Oldorf Hospice House for all the love and support they showed Jeanette while she was in their care.
